Florida Republicans have sent out a series of transphobic campaign mailers in recent weeks targeting state House District 65 candidate Ashley Brundage, who could become the state’s first transgender lawmaker if elected next month.
Tallahassee has become adept at passing anti-trans legislation without even having a transgender member in either the state House or Senate. Ashley Brundage is looking to change that.

Call it “Don’t Search Gay.” Florida Gov. Ron DeSantis has removed the “LGBTQ Travel” section from the state’s website. Until recently, visitflorida.com, the state’s marketing website, featured a landing page for LGBTQ travel resources and business promotion.
In a scene more reminiscent of a country where censorship and repression thrive, hundreds of books — many with LGBTQ themes and religious studies — were reportedly seen being transported to a landfill. The scene was captured on film and went viral, the Sarasota Herald Tribune first reported.
